Location

Situated on the banks of Thac Ba Lake, in Vu Linh Commune, Yen Binh District, Ngoi Tu Village is a haven of charm and tranquility. Just 200 kilometers away from the bustling heart of Hanoi, this hidden gem awaits your discovery.

What Makes Ngoi Tu Village Special

For over two decades, Ngoi Tu Village has been a vibrant hub of culture and tourism. Home to various ethnic minorities such as Dao, Nung, and Cao Lan, it is the Dao Quan Trang (Dao people with white pants) who make up the largest group here.

With approximately 130 households, the village proudly preserves its rich cultural heritage. From its distinctive three-storey house architecture to traditional handicrafts, local cuisine, folk songs, and captivating festivals, Ngoi Tu Village offers a glimpse into a world steeped in tradition.

Join Traditional Festivals

If you happen to visit during the festive season, you’ll have the chance to immerse yourself in the local culture and witness the well-preserved traditions of Ngoi Tu Village. Engage in the captivating Cap Sac ceremony, a significant ritual in Dao men’s lives, or witness the exhilarating fire jumping festival. Experience the warmth of a traditional wedding ceremony or savor the joys of the “Com Moi” festival, a celebration of the year’s new rice harvest. How to Get There

From Hanoi

By car or motorbike, take Highway 32 followed by Highway 2 (Tuyen Quang direction) and then Highway 37 for approximately 150 kilometers. You will find yourself in the heart of Ngoi Tu Village, ready to embark on your unforgettable journey.

From Yen Binh District, Yen Bai

By car or motorbike, head towards Highway 37/70 in the direction of Hanoi. Proceed to Thac Ba Town and then take Street 170 to Vu Linh Commune, eventually reaching Ngoi Tu Village. For a more adventurous option, consider a motor-boat ride on Thac Ba Lake, departing from Huong Ly port in Yen Binh Center, and arriving at Ngoi Tu Village after a scenic 50-minute journey.
